WYOMING-1951: An antelope walks across a vast, arid prairie landscape captured on 8mm film. The view is framed by a dark border, suggesting footage shot from a vehicle window. A wooden telephone pole stands in the right foreground, while the distant horizon stretches under a pale sky. The terrain is covered in sparse shrubs and dry grass, with the antelope moving steadily across the open plain. The image exhibits natural film grain, slight blurriness, and subtle color fading typical of vintage home movie footage from the early 1950s.
